Gold nanorod-based fluorometric ELISA for the sensitive detection of a cancer biomarker

Abstract: A gold nanorod-based fluorometric immunoassay (nanoELIFA) displayed ∼3.5-fold higher sensitivity (amplified signal) when compared to conventional ELIFA.
